Restore Your Tile & Grout: A Step-by-Step Guide
Over time , tile and grout can appear dull, stained and unattractive . Thankfully, restoring them is a remarkably easy task ! First, completely sweep the area to eliminate loose debris. Next, prepare a cleaning mixture - often a combination of baking soda and solution. Apply the mixture to the grout lines and let it dwell for about 5-10 minutes . Then, using a durable brush, scrub the grout vigorously. Finally, flush the tile and grout with pure water and permit it to dry completely for a newer looking floor .

Are Grout Dirty? A Guide To Clean Ceramic Effectively
That discolored grout between your ceramic surfaces is probably a sign of grime and accumulated buildup. Don't ignoring it! A easy cleaning can really improve This website the appearance. Start by vacuuming away loose particles. Then, mix a concoction of baking soda and water. Apply the mixture to the grout, let it sit for several minutes, and clean with a stiff-bristled brush. Remove thoroughly and let it air dry. For tougher stains, consider a commercial cleaner or even a specialized equipment.
{Tile & Grout Cleaning: Typical Blunders to Avoid and Ideal Approaches
Cleaning the and joint can be a challenge, and it’s simple to make some mistakes that can harm surfaces. Avoid using harsh chemicals, as these can discolor the surface or strip the sealant. Be Sure To test a cleaning compound in a inconspicuous area first. Regularly scrubbing too hard can chip the grout , so use soft brush. Rather Than relying solely on sprays , consider applying a vapor action cleaner for better cleaning. Finally , rinse thoroughly after applying to eliminate film.
